Best Practices for Automating Campaign Performance Dashboards

In today’s digital marketing landscape, real-time insights are crucial for optimizing campaign performance. Automating dashboards allows marketers to monitor key metrics efficiently, saving time and improving decision-making. This article explores best practices for creating effective automated campaign performance dashboards.

Define Clear Objectives and Metrics

Before setting up an automated dashboard, it is essential to identify what success looks like. Determine the key performance indicators (KPIs) that align with your campaign goals. Common metrics include click-through rates, conversion rates, cost per acquisition, and return on ad spend.

Choose the Right Tools and Platforms

Select tools that integrate seamlessly with your data sources. Popular options include Google Data Studio, Tableau, Power BI, and specialized marketing analytics platforms. Ensure the chosen tool supports automation features such as scheduled data refreshes and real-time updates.

Integrate Multiple Data Sources

Effective dashboards consolidate data from various platforms like Google Ads, Facebook Ads, Google Analytics, and email marketing tools. Use APIs or connectors to automate data extraction, reducing manual effort and minimizing errors.

Design Intuitive and Actionable Dashboards

Focus on clarity and usability. Use visualizations such as charts, heatmaps, and gauges to represent data clearly. Highlight critical metrics and set up alerts for significant deviations to enable quick responses.

Automate Data Refresh and Reporting

Schedule regular data updates to ensure your dashboard reflects the latest campaign performance. Automate report generation and distribution to stakeholders to facilitate timely insights and actions.

Implement Continuous Improvement

Regularly review your dashboard setup and metrics to ensure they remain aligned with evolving campaign goals. Incorporate feedback from users and adapt visualizations and data sources as needed to enhance effectiveness.

Train Your Team

Ensure team members understand how to interpret dashboard data. Provide training sessions and documentation to maximize the value of automated insights.
